As a species, we've never had it so good. We're living longer and healthier lives than ever before; the sum of human knowledge and endless entertainment are only ever a few clicks away.

So why are we in the midst of a mental health crisis?

The Happiness Cure offers a radical new way to think about fulfilment. Blending neuroscientific research and empirical breakthroughs with stories of ordinary individuals, leading psychiatrist and viral TedX speaker Dr Anders Hansen reveals that by adopting an evolutionary take on life, we can re-set our perspective on happiness to find longer-term meaning and lasting contentment.

Quick fascinating insight into the human psyche

Wed, 29 Mar 2023 | Review by: Natisha J.

"Whether you think you can, or you think you can't - you're right Henry Ford" This is a well-researched work simplifies multiple sources of research, into clearly defined easy ro digest chapters. These are clearly mapped to explain the different factors impacting the individual's need for happiness. Any book that delves so deeply into the neuroscience and evolution could easily end up as dry as a textbook but @andershansen avoided this but providing smaller chunks of information in simple terms that are written with the common reader in mind. This books explores anxiety and why this is a sign of your brain functioning as it should and the importance of exercise and hope in preventing depression and overall is a fascinating look at the complexities of the human brain and our space in the evolution cycle. Definitely pick this up to gain insight into what makes you, you - it truly will change the way that you look at mental health.
